[R]eports today from several agencies including Reuters and CBS News
reveal the administration knew precisely what was going on almost immediately, courtesy of emails.
Sharyl Attkisson at CBS says: “At 4:05 p.m. Eastern time, on September 11, an alert from the State Department Operations Center was issued to a number government and intelligence agencies. Included were the White House Situation Room, the office of the Director of National Intelligence, and the FBI. 
“‘US Diplomatic Mission in Benghazi Under Attack” — “approximately 20 armed people fired shots; explosions have been heard as well. Ambassador Stevens, who is currently in Benghazi, and four COM (Chief of Mission/embassy) personnel are in the compound safe haven.’”
And Reuters reports the emails specifically mention the Libyan group called Ansar al-Sharia had asserted responsibility for the attacks.
